Typical Issues with Porsche Key Fobs

Key fobs might display several issues that can affect their efficiency. Comprehending these issues can assist owners make notified decisions about repair or replacement.

1. Dead Battery

Among the most typical concerns that Porsche owners come across with their key fobs is a dead battery. This usually manifests as an unresponsive fob or a decreased variety of operation.

2. Physical Damage

Dropping the key fob or exposing it to water can cause internal damage. Typical indications of physical damage consist of cracked cases or malfunctioning buttons.

3. Programming Issues

Occasionally, a key fob may lose its programming, needing reprogramming. This typically occurs after replacing a battery or if the fob has actually been used with a different car.

4. Button Malfunction

The buttons on the key fob may stop working due to use and tear, dirt build-up, or internal damage.

Troubleshooting Your Key Fob

If you’re experiencing issues with your Porsche Key Replacement Near Me key fob, here’s a troubleshooting list to assist you determine the issue:

  1. Check the Battery

    • Replace the battery with a new one.
    • Utilize a multimeter to determine the battery voltage if required.
  2. Examine for Physical Damage

    • Search for fractures or indications of water damage.
    • Check that all buttons are intact and practical.
  3. Reprogram the Fob

    • Follow your owner’s manual directions to reset the fob.
    • You might need to speak with an expert if reprogramming doesn’t work.
  4. Clean the Contacts

    • Open the fob and tidy the internal contacts carefully using rubbing alcohol.
  5. Test with Another Key Fob

    • If available, check your vehicle with another key fob to determine if the problem is with the fob or the car’s receiver.

Repair Options

If fixing doesn’t fix the problem, several repair choices are available.

1. DIY Repair

Numerous easy issues can be repaired at home. Here’s a fundamental DIY repair guide:

Tools Required:

  • Small Phillips screwdriver
  • Replacement battery
  • Rubbing alcohol
  • Cotton bud

Steps:

  1. Open the key fob with the screwdriver.
  2. Remove the old battery and replace it with a new one.
  3. Check the internal elements for damage; tidy contacts if needed.
  4. Reassemble the fob and test it.
